⢠Future-Ready Power Distribution Fundamentals: An introduction to the key concepts and trends shaping the future of power distribution, including smart grids, renewable energy integration, and energy storage.
⢠Power Distribution System Design: Best practices for designing power distribution systems that are efficient, reliable, and scalable, with a focus on advanced technologies such as microgrids and distributed generation.
⢠Power Electronics and Controls: An overview of the latest power electronics and control technologies for power distribution systems, including AC and DC converters, motor drives, and power quality solutions.
⢠Data Analytics and Cybersecurity for Power Distribution: Strategies for leveraging data analytics and cybersecurity best practices to optimize power distribution system performance, enhance grid reliability, and protect against cyber threats.
⢠Renewable Energy Integration and Energy Storage: Technologies and strategies for integrating renewable energy sources into power distribution systems, including solar, wind, and energy storage systems, and the role of electric vehicles.
⢠Power Distribution Automation and Smart Grids: An exploration of the latest automation and control technologies for power distribution systems, including smart grid applications, distribution automation, and advanced metering infrastructure.
⢠Regulatory and Policy Frameworks for Future-Ready Power Distribution: An overview of the regulatory and policy frameworks that govern power distribution systems, including emerging trends and best practices for promoting innovation, competition, and sustainability.
⢠Power Distribution System Maintenance and Operations: Best practices for operating and maintaining power distribution systems, including safety procedures, preventive maintenance strategies, and fault diagnosis and repair.
⢠Ethics and Professional Responsibility in Power Distribution: A review of the ethical and professional standards that apply to power distribution professionals, including codes of conduct, professional certifications, and best practices for responsible innovation.
